Yankee Great Bobby Richardson Talks On The Team
Mike Lindsley recently talked on The Team with Yankee great Bobby Richardson (pictured above right next to Yogi Berra), a three-time World Series champion and 1960 World Series MVP (still the only player from a losing team in the Fall Classic to win the award)...

Knicks Can Only Do So Much At Center
So many Knicks fans point towards the fact that Roy Hibbert was a handful in the conference semifinals for the Pacers. Fair argument. But Tyson Chandler's failure against Hibbert and mainly his overall role and ability are only a small part of what is wrong with New York's most popular hoops team.

Rangers Need Power-Play and Stars To Come Through
Goaltending-depth-star scoring-special teams. Those are the four keys to a Stanley Cup run. The Rangers certainly have the first one, even if Henrik Lundqvist had a bad Game 2 against the Bruins. Other than the goalie though, the Blueshirts are in trouble.
